Output ecf731efc18f3c968cd5b3c2380b9763cbc03cd92d6a6e4eff8040214a68f2b5:0

value
19235735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a8aa09d767836c1504f12c890ef26e637f43497 OP_EQUAL
address
MBn6gVFRxk2KQLVPWENbiEL6vuY84JYZii
transaction
ecf731efc18f3c968cd5b3c2380b9763cbc03cd92d6a6e4eff8040214a68f2b5
spent
true